How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Bellview?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Bellview 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,497 | $1,002 | $2,392 |
| Bellview 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,641 | $925 | $2,674 |
| Bellview 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,161 | $1,360 | $6,819 |
| Bellview 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,050 | $2,050 | $2,050 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Bellview
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Bellview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Bellview ranges from $1,002 to $2,392 with an average monthly rent of $1,497.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Bellview c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Bellview range from $925 to $2,674.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,641.
How expensive are Bellview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 19 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Bellview on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,360 to $6,819 - averaging $2,161 for the location.
